Sqlserver
 sql >> база данни >  >> RDS >> Sqlserver

Разберете колко хиляди, стотици и десетици има в една сума

Простият отговор е да разделите числото на 1000, каквото и да е частното, което е числото на 1000 в сумата. След това разделете остатъка на 100-те, частното ще бъде числото на 100-те. И след това отново разделете остатъка на 10, частното ще бъде броят на десетиците

Нещо подобно:

quotient = 3660 / 1000;     //This will give you 3
remainder = 3660 % 1000;    //This will give you 660

След това,

quotient1 = remainder/ 100;     //This will give you 6
remainder1 = remainder % 100;    //This will give you 60

И накрая

quotient2 = remainder1 / 10;     //This will give you 6 


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Добавяне на стъпка на задача към съществуваща задача на агент на SQL Server (T-SQL)

  2. SUBSTRING() и шестнадесетична стойност

  3. sql server 2008 management studio не проверява синтаксиса на моята заявка

  4. SQL Server 2005 Използване на DateAdd за добавяне на ден към дата

  5. Експортирайте таблица във файл със заглавки на колони (имена на колони) с помощта на помощната програма bcp и SQL Server 2008